"Really good prices, really fast service, large portions, tasty food, and free dessert. You cannot go wrong eating here. We checked out Youngblood’s Cafe because it was mentioned by Texas blogger the Day Tripper, who travels all over Texas in search of hidden gems. I have to say this place lived up to the hype. We were all pleased by the service and food. Walking into Youngblood’s Cafe makes you feel as if you’ve stepped into a true Texan eatery. Kitschy Texas decor is everywhere and you know a restaurant is good when the place is packed. We arrived around lunch, we were seated right away, and the food arrived almost immediately after we placed our order. I had the Cajun style grilled catfish and I was happy with the level of heat and flavor. My meal came with a choice of soup or salad and I opted for the soup of the day - Navy bean soup, which was delicious! Other dishes ordered were the chicken fried chicken and Vicki’s Chicken Fried Steak. I have to say, I was curious about tasting Vicki’s Chicken fried steak because green chili sauce + gravy sounded strange (never had chicken fried steak this way before) and I was really surprised how wonderful it tasted. I would definitely recommend this dish! And finally, as we were finishing up our meal, a server carrying a huge platter of banana pudding dishes swung by our table and asked us if we wanted dessert. Overall, this restaurant was a huge hit with all of us and if I’m ever in Amarillo again I’m planning on stopping in for another delicious meal."
